Hockey in iron ore inquiry talks

Independent Senator Nick Xenophon wants a bipartisan parliamentary committee to hold an inquiry into iron ore pricing. There is speculation that any such inquiry could be chaired by Liberal MP Angus Taylor, who has worked as a consultant in the sector. Minerals Council of Australia CEO Brendan Pearson rejects claims by Andrew Forrest that BHP Billiton and Rio Tinto are ramping up production with a view to forcing smaller producers out of the iron ore market, and says there is no need for an inquiry.
